Output 71b95377f9a05efd2f16675cfe84d4eff49bb34f0a4c65c2ff5089a20ceb0bf3:2

value
53470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893743659801bfb3b2f2d7317080f988f3b1c669 OP_EQUAL
address
3ECYhap2tEpcdLkqmtuo8fbRGkKcn28FRh
transaction
71b95377f9a05efd2f16675cfe84d4eff49bb34f0a4c65c2ff5089a20ceb0bf3
confirmations
316520
spent
true